Agarwa at a glance

Agarwa is a village of 7,726 people in 1,537 households (Census 2011) in Thasra taluka, Kheda district, Gujarat, the 3rd-largest of 68 villages in Thasra taluka. Literacy is 66%, 3 points below the taluka average of 69% and the sex ratio is 923 women per 1,000 men. The pincode is 388230, served by Kalsar post office; the LGD village code is 517759. The village votes in Kadi assembly constituency, represented by MLA Karsanbhai Punjabhai Solanki. The population is estimated at 9,109 in 2026, up 18% since the 2011 Census.
